The main purpose of the Site Assistant is to ensure the smooth and safe operation of the school premises. The Site Assistant contributes to the overall school environment, enhancing the learning experience by ensuring that the school remains functional, safe, and welcoming at all times. The Site Assistant plays a vital role in maintaining a clean, secure, and well-functioning environment for pupils, staff, and visitors. They are responsible for a range of duties, including but not limited to site maintenance, health and safety compliance, emergency cleaning, and assisting with deliveries.
